Transaction 1c17929a36d693aa18f4d2c673a7ffb7b3dc241a1c2018a03cf37c84c3d094d8
1 Input
1 Output
-
1c17929a36d693aa18f4d2c673a7ffb7b3dc241a1c2018a03cf37c84c3d094d8:0
- value
- 9094229
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 742cec6582926f8069765442d353a51a57f49098 OP_EQUAL
- address
- 3CHJ88WaCAXrXDjWoppme28p5Cr2KWZHDU